### Account Recovery — Catalogue Import (Lintwood)

Quick one for review: when the Lintwood catalogue import wipes a patron's session table, the recovery flow re-seeds accounts from the nightly snapshot. Check that the importer skips locked accounts — last time it didn't. To rerun recovery against staging you'll need the vault passphrase, which is appended just below.

recovery phrase for yafof-tajof: julmir-kelax-julvan-holath-belvan-holir-ralael-ralvan-ralath-julvan-silmir-istmir-kaswyn-ulamir

## Break-Glass: QueueWarden Autoscaler

QueueWarden scales workers based on queue depth for the Larkspur batch platform. If the control plane is unreachable and queues are backing up, use break-glass access to pin worker counts manually.

Notify the on-call lead first, then open the emergency console from the jump host. Access requires the recovery passphrase that follows.

unlock words, hahip-baduf: holwyn-istath-julvan

Meeting notes — HSM delivery, Bay 3 (excerpt). The Crestlock HSM unit from Vantrell Systems arrives Tuesday, single tamper-sealed case. Shift lead to verify the seal number against the manifest before signing, photograph all six sides, and move it directly to the security cage — no staging on the floor. Per Vantrell protocol, the courier releases the case only upon hearing this phrase:

courier memo of yahif-faweg: the quenael tamius courier leaves the prawyn jorix kaswyn istox silmir brieth zormir fenvan ledger at gate 3145 under passcode 231062

Handover note — Sheetforge export memory

Before you review my branch: the Sheetforge XLSX exporter was buffering entire workbooks in memory, spiking to 6 GB on large tenants. I switched it to streamed row writes with a bounded cell cache. Watch for the checkpoint logic in the flush path — that's the risky part. To run the integration suite you'll need to unlock the fixtures vault; the recovery passphrase is appended just below.

vault phrase of tawef-baduf = julox-eliir-ulaix-rusok-novael-sorael-tammir-ulaok-casvan-rusius-olimir-kasath-kelius